I Blame Coco Concert History

I Blame Coco (stylised I Blåme Coco) was the alias of the pop UK musician Eliot Sumner. They were supported by a backing band that included Jonny Mott (keyboards), Alexis Nunez (drums), Jonas Jalhay (guitar) and Rory Andrew (bass). In 2014, Eliot announced that they will release new music with their own name.

When was the last I Blame Coco concert?

The last I Blame Coco concert was on July 27, 2012 at Lotnisko Bemowo in Warsaw, Mazovia, Poland. The bands that performed were: Red Hot Chili Peppers / Kasabian / The Vaccines / The Charlatans / Public Image Ltd. / Marlon Roudette / I Blame Coco.
